The South American rubber tree grew only inside the Amazon rainforest, and increasing desire and the invention on the vulcanization process in 1839 led to the Lumber rubber increase in that location, enriching the metropolitan areas of Belém, Santarém, and Manaus in Brazil and Iquitos, Peru, from 1840 to 1913. In Brazil, ahead of the name was changed to 'Seringueira' the Preliminary name on the plant was 'pará rubber tree', derived with the identify in the province of Grão-Pará. In Peru, the here tree was named 'árbol del caucho', as well as latex extracted from it absolutely was called 'caucho'. The tree was employed to obtain rubber through the natives who inhabited its geographical distribution. The Olmec men and women of Mesoamerica extracted and generated very similar varieties of primitive rubber from analogous latex-developing trees including Castilla elastica as early as 3,600 decades back.
